Abstract
The lumbar support assistive device includes a plastic rigid main member having a half-fusiform whose front side curves in accordance with human spine. A trough is provided along the front side extended in an axial direction to a bottom side of the main member. A number of forward bulging semi-ellipsoidal elements are arranged at intervals in two columns along lateral sides of the trough. The semi-ellipsoidal elements closer to a bottom of the main member are wider and higher; and the semi-ellipsoidal elements closer to a top of the main member are narrower and lower, and they are closer to the semi-ellipsoidal elements in the other column These semi-ellipsoidal elements provide massaging effect and support to corresponding intervertebral discs of the spine. The semi-ellipsoidal elements also raise the lumbar support assistive device to provide enhanced ventilation so that wearing the lumbar support assistive device would not feel sultry.
Claims
1. A lumbar support assistive device, comprising: a plastic rigid main member having a half-fusiform whose front side curves in accordance with human spine; a trough along the front side extended in an axial direction to a bottom side of the main member; a plurality of forward bulging semi-ellipsoidal elements arranged at intervals in two columns along lateral sides of the trough; wherein the semi-ellipsoidal elements closer to a bottom of the main member are wider and higher; and the semi-ellipsoidal elements closer to a top side of the main member are narrower and lower, and they are closer to the semi-ellipsoidal elements in the other column
2. The lumbar support assistive device according to claim 1, wherein the main member has a length 185-210 mm and a width 7-11 cm.
3. The lumbar support assistive device according to claim 1, wherein the semi-ellipsoidal elements are disposed at 3-5 cm intervals within each column
4. The lumbar support assistive device according to claim 1, wherein the semi-ellipsoidal elements have bulging heights 14-8.5 mm, and widths 13.5-9 mm; the bottommost semi-ellipsoidal elements have the greatest bulging heights; and the semi-ellipsoidal elements have decreasing bulging heights as they are positioned higher on the main member.
5. The lumbar support assistive device according to claim 1, wherein the main member is made of a hard rubber, plastic, or Acrylonitrile Butadiene Styrene (ABS) material.
6. The lumbar support assistive device according to claim 5, wherein the material has a Shore hardness between 60 and 80 degrees.
7. The lumbar support assistive device according to claim 1, further comprising a plastic layer of a thickness 2-5 mm on the front side of the main member.
8. The lumbar support assistive device according to claim 7, wherein the plastic layer is made of environmentally friendly silicone or a flexible environmentally friendly material.
9. The lumbar support assistive device according to claim 1, further comprising a tail piece extended from a bottom side of the main member for tugging inside clothes and positioning the main member.
10. The lumbar support assistive device according to claim 9, wherein the tail piece is made of a flexible material.

[0012] The gist of the present invention is as follows. The main member 10 is positioned around a user's lumbar for superior support. The plastic layer 11 provides a comfort contact surface. The trough 12 allows leeway to the spine to avoid the discomfort of pressing and contacting the spine. The semi-ellipsoidal elements 13 to the sides of the trough 12 reliably press the two sides of the intervertebral discs and raise the main member from the user's back for enhanced ventilation. The user would not feel sultry even after long period of usage. Especially, the decreasing heights of the semi-ellipsoidal elements 13 as they are positioned higher provide complete support to the spine and enhanced massaging as the user moves. The tail piece 14 provides addition positioning to the main member as it may be tugged into waist belt or clothes. The belt 20 further provides reliable fastening of the main member 10 to the user's waist. The curved front side and rigid material of the main member 10 jointly provide comfort and support.
